YouTube experienced technical difficulties on Wednesday, Oct. 15, with hundreds of thousands of users reporting problems.
According to the outage-tracking website Downdetector, reports at around 7:59 p.m. ET were around 358,000 and rising. In a post on X, formerly Twitter, Downdetector said users began reporting problems with YouTube at 7:19 p.m. ET.
YouTube confirmed the outage on X and said they were working on a fix.
"If you’re not able to play videos on YouTube right now – we’re on it!," YouTube said.
